黑狐家游戏

分布式对象存储设备包括什么,分布式对象存储设备包括

欧气 3 0

本文目录导读:

  1. 分布式架构
  2. 对象存储模型
  3. 数据分布和复制
  4. 元数据管理
  5. 访问控制和权限管理
  6. 网络通信和协议
  7. 数据压缩和加密
  8. 管理和监控系统

标题:探索分布式对象存储设备的构成要素

在当今数字化时代,数据的存储和管理变得至关重要,分布式对象存储设备作为一种高效、可靠的数据存储解决方案,正逐渐受到广泛关注,分布式对象存储设备包括哪些关键要素呢?本文将深入探讨分布式对象存储设备的组成部分,帮助您更好地了解其工作原理和优势。

分布式架构

分布式对象存储设备采用分布式架构,将数据分散存储在多个节点上,这种架构具有以下优点:

1、高可用性:通过多个节点的冗余备份,可以提高系统的可靠性,即使某个节点出现故障,也不会影响数据的可用性。

2、可扩展性:可以轻松地添加新的节点来扩展存储容量和性能,满足不断增长的业务需求。

3、负载均衡:能够自动分配数据读写请求到各个节点,实现负载均衡,提高系统的整体性能。

对象存储模型

分布式对象存储设备采用对象存储模型,将数据视为对象进行存储和管理,每个对象都包含数据本身、元数据(如文件名、创建时间、访问权限等)和对象的唯一标识符,这种模型具有以下优点:

1、简单灵活:对象存储模型简单直观,易于理解和使用,适合各种类型的数据存储需求。

2、高性能:通过对对象的直接读写操作,可以实现高速的数据访问,提高系统的性能。

3、支持多种数据类型:可以存储各种类型的数据,如文件、图像、视频、音频等,满足不同业务场景的需求。

数据分布和复制

为了保证数据的可靠性和可用性,分布式对象存储设备需要将数据分布在多个节点上,并进行复制,数据分布可以采用哈希算法或其他数据分配策略,确保数据在各个节点上的均匀分布,数据复制可以采用同步复制或异步复制方式,同步复制可以保证数据的一致性,但会降低系统的性能;异步复制可以提高系统的性能,但可能会存在数据不一致的风险。

元数据管理

元数据管理是分布式对象存储设备的重要组成部分,它负责管理对象的元数据,元数据管理包括元数据的存储、查询、更新和删除等操作,为了提高元数据的管理效率,分布式对象存储设备通常采用分布式元数据管理系统,将元数据分散存储在多个节点上,实现元数据的高可用性和可扩展性。

访问控制和权限管理

访问控制和权限管理是分布式对象存储设备的重要安全机制,它负责控制对数据的访问权限,访问控制和权限管理可以采用基于角色的访问控制(RBAC)或基于属性的访问控制(ABAC)等策略,根据用户的角色、身份和属性等信息来控制对数据的访问权限。

网络通信和协议

网络通信和协议是分布式对象存储设备的重要组成部分,它负责实现节点之间的通信和数据传输,分布式对象存储设备通常采用网络文件系统(NFS)、通用互联网文件系统(CIFS)、对象存储协议(如 S3、Swift 等)等协议来实现数据的存储和访问。

数据压缩和加密

为了节省存储空间和提高数据传输效率,分布式对象存储设备可以采用数据压缩和加密技术,数据压缩可以减少数据的存储空间,提高存储效率;数据加密可以保护数据的安全性,防止数据泄露和篡改。

管理和监控系统

管理和监控系统是分布式对象存储设备的重要组成部分,它负责对设备进行管理和监控,管理和监控系统可以提供设备的配置管理、性能监控、故障报警等功能,帮助管理员及时发现和解决问题,保证设备的正常运行。

分布式对象存储设备包括分布式架构、对象存储模型、数据分布和复制、元数据管理、访问控制和权限管理、网络通信和协议、数据压缩和加密以及管理和监控系统等多个要素,这些要素相互协作,共同构成了一个高效、可靠的数据存储解决方案,随着数字化时代的不断发展,分布式对象存储设备将在未来的数据存储领域发挥越来越重要的作用。

标签: #分布式 #对象存储 #设备 #包括

黑狐家游戏
  • 评论列表

留言评论